### Add streaming parse to the CSV import wizard

Hey, this swaps the old load-everything approach in Sheetloaf's import wizard for a streaming parser. Big files no longer blow up the worker, and we show row-level progress now. Delimiter sniffing got smarter too — it samples the head of the file instead of guessing. Review the limits carefully since they cap user uploads. Here are the tuning constants I landed on.

limits module of yadug-tawip:
QUOTAS = {
    "julael": 705,
    "kasael": 903,
    "druwyn": 489,
}

Glyphline renders the dependency graph for all Marrowfield services. If the on-call dashboard shows layout timeouts, the usual culprit is an oversized transitive closure from the ingest tier. The renderer degrades to clustered mode automatically once node counts exceed the cap. The thresholds that control this behavior are defined below.

tuning constants:
QUOTAS = {
    "quenael": 10,
    "oliwyn": 1,
}

### Step 3 — Point the bounce processor at the new queue DB

Almost done! The Pelicanmail bounce processor now reads suppression entries from the consolidated queue database instead of the old flat files. Stop the worker, run `migrate-bounces --verify`, and confirm zero pending rows before restarting. The worker picks up its target from config. Set it to the connection string below.

primary connection of yagep-kahip = redis://giliel_svc:zYiKsLL2PLpfPL@db-348f.xolmarsys.corp:5432/fenwyn